Labour — Pontefract, Castleford and Knottingley

Speaking in the House of Commons on 16 June 2025

Debate

Child Sexual Exploitation: Casey Report

Contribution

I welcome the hon. Member’s point. It is immensely important that victims and survivors in every community of every ethnicity can get justice and the support they need, and that issues around race and ethnicity are never used as an excuse to ignore victims or to fail to pursue criminals committing the most terrible crimes. We want to work with the police to ensure not only that we can get effective data and recording on victims, but that the right kind of services and support are in place so that every victim is heard.
